### Account Recovery — Catalogue Import (Lintwood)

Quick one for review: when the Lintwood catalogue import wipes a patron's session table, the recovery flow re-seeds accounts from the nightly snapshot. Check that the importer skips locked accounts — last time it didn't. To rerun recovery against staging you'll need the vault passphrase, which is appended just below.

recovery phrase for yafof-tajof: julmir-kelax-julvan-holath-belvan-holir-ralael-ralvan-ralath-julvan-silmir-istmir-kaswyn-ulamir

Subject: Stale-cache postmortem — please read before your first shift

Hi,

Welcome to the Veldrome rotation. Last month's stale-cache bug in the Quillcast pricing layer is required reading — it explains why we now double-flush on deploy. Review the remediation diffs too; two are still open. The full postmortem is posted here.

runbook for badug-kadup: https://confluence.zemvarlabs.internal/projects/browse/display/projects/bd1b

Handover for the eng sync: the flaky DNS resolution in Tarnbridge's lookup pods traces to a stale resolver cache after node recycling. Oren added a forced refresh on restart; still monitoring. If it recurs, use the diagnostics vault on the bastion, which opens with the recovery passphrase noted directly below.

recovery phrase for bawep-kawef: oliath-casdor

**Mgmt Meeting Minutes — Retiring the Brightline Range**

Quick recap for sales leads at Fenholt Supplies: we agreed to retire the Brightline fixture range by year-end. Remaining stock moves to clearance pricing next month, and accounts on standing orders get migrated to the Lumetta range. Trade-in incentives were approved in principle. The confidential note on next steps sits just below.

board note of bajof-bajeg: The pricing group signed off on a budget of $13.4 million for Project Sildor. The renewal with Lamixek Holdings closes at $48.9 million a year, 49 percent above the last contract.